Ninja Creami Classic Vanilla Ice Cream

Ingredients
  

  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1 cup whole milk
  • ½ cup granulated sugar
  • 1 tablespoon vanilla extract or vanilla bean paste for richer flavor
  • Pinch of salt

Instructions
 

  • Make the Ice Cream Base:
  • In a mixing bowl, whisk together the heavy cream, milk, sugar, vanilla extract, and salt until the sugar is fully dissolved.
  • Freeze the Base:
  • Pour the mixture into your Ninja Creami pint container.
  • Seal with the lid and freeze completely flat for at least 24 hours.
  • Process in the Ninja Creami:
  • Remove the pint from the freezer. Install it into the Ninja Creami machine.
  • Select the “Ice Cream” function and let it run.
  • Check Texture & Re-spin if Needed:
  • If the ice cream is crumbly or too firm, use the “Re-spin” function for a smoother, creamier consistency.
  • Serve & Enjoy:
  • Scoop and serve immediately, or return to the freezer for later.
  • For added fun, try mix-ins after the first cycle using the “Mix-In” setting!

Notes

  • For a softer texture, add 1-2 tablespoons of corn syrup to the base before freezing.
  • Want a lighter version? Swap heavy cream for half-and-half and use a sugar substitute.
  • Enhance the flavor by using vanilla bean paste instead of extract for an even richer vanilla taste.
  • Mix-ins: Stir in chocolate chips, caramel swirls, or crushed cookies after the first cycle for extra texture and flavor.
